微软TTS API 接口: wss://eastus.tts.speech.microsoft.com/cognitiveservices/websocket/v1 edge API 接口: wss://speech.platform.bing.com/consumer/speech/synthesize/readaloud/edge/v1
通过Cloudflare Worker 上的代理服务实现免费使用edge-ttsapi 接口,从而实现类似模型接口调用的效果。 3.edge-tts-openai-cf-worker edge-tts-openai-cf-worker目前在github仓库地址https://github.com/linshenkx/edge-tts-openai-cf-worker 我们需要在Cloudflare 把对应的worker.js 脚本部署上去。 登录https://dash....
项目地址:https://github.com/travisvn/openai-edge-tts 核心特点 OpenAI 兼容 API提供/v1/audio/speech端点,与 OpenAI API 端点结构一致,方便用户无缝切换到本地化服务。 支持丰富的语音类型将 OpenAI 的语音选项(如 alloy、echo、fable 等)映射到 Edge-TTS 的等效语音,同时支持直接指定任何 Microsoft Edge-TTS ...
OpenAI-Edge-TTS是一个模拟 OpenAI TTS 端点(/v1/audio/speech)的本地服务,使用 Microsoft Edge 在线 TTS 服务来生成语音。通过这款工具,用户无需访问 OpenAI 的官方 API,只需通过本地服务器即可实现文本转语音的功能,同时还支持多种语音和音频格式选项。 项目地址:https:///travisvn/openai-edge-tts 核心特点...
运行python tts.py,稍等即可在d盘生成合成后的音频test.mp3。 6.实现原理 原理非常简单,就是调用了微软的在线语音合成服务,看一下源码中的constants.py和communicate.py便可猜出大概,语音合成是用的websocket服务,获取声音列表是用的https接口,但是作者不知道这个TrustedClientToken是怎样得到的,也没有搜到官方的api文...
在python环境下使用该接口必须要安装模块 pip install baidu-aip 1. 安装成功可见如下提示 生成一段语音 通过查看百度语音合成的技术文档,可以发现如下的几个参数: 将这些参数传递到技术文档所给的框架中,就可以生成一段语音: from aip import AipSpeechapp_id = '你的Appid'api_key = '你的API key'secret_key...
edge-tts 是一个Python的库,继承了微软 Azure 的文本转语音功能(TTS),且是免费使用的。该库提供了一个简单的API,可以将文本转换为语音,并且支持多种语言和声音。 只需要一行代码,即可将文本转换为语音! 代码语言:javascript 代码运行次数:0 运行 AI代码解释 ...
Edge-TTS 的工作原理主要基于以下几个方面: 1. 调用Azure Cognitive Services API:这个库通过调用微软Azure的在线API来执行文本转语音的任务。 2. 简单的API接口:Edge-TTS提供了易于使用的API,允许开发者直接在Python代码中将文本转换为语音。 3. 多语言和声音支持:该服务支持多种语言和声音选项,使得生成的语音文件...
Explore voice samples and use Edge TTS as a free, OpenAI-compatible text-to-speech API. Powered by Microsoft Edge for natural, high-quality voice synthesis.
在Azure平台上,我们可以轻松获取Edge-TTS服务的API密钥,并使用该密钥来调用服务。 (1)配置Edge-TTS服务:在Azure平台上创建Edge-TTS服务实例,并获取API密钥。然后,在代码中配置Edge-TTS服务的参数,如语言、音调、语速等。 (2)调用Edge-TTS API:将需要合成的文本内容发送到Edge-TTS服务的API接口,并接收返回的语音...